At more than four minutes this is the longest treatment of the subject in the library, and the extra time is spent on the part short clips skip: that the arguments divide into three separable questions. Whether consumers can tell what they are buying is a labelling question. Whether ranchers can compete is an economic one. Whether the product is safe long-term is an evidentiary one with limited data either way. They can be answered differently.

Several states have taken up restrictions with different approaches. For the status of any specific Nevada measure rather than the debate around it, the bill text and history are published by the Nevada Legislature.
